Secure Operations in BMS Management: Mitigating Digital Threats for Facility Operations

The increasing adoption on Building Management Systems (BMS) presents critical issues related to digital safety . Connected building systems, while improving efficiency , also expand the vulnerability window for cybercriminals . To secure critical infrastructure , a preventative approach to digital security is crucial . This involves establishing robust defensive techniques, including:

  • Regular penetration testing
  • Strong access controls
  • Personnel training on cybersecurity best practices
  • Network segmentation to limit the impact of potential breaches
  • Implementing intrusion detection tools

Ultimately , focusing on digital safety is vital for guaranteeing the stability and integrity of facility management .
